// Various helper functions and utilities
 | 
						|
 | 
						|
#pragma once
 | 
						|
 | 
						|
#include "llama.h"
 | 
						|
 | 
						|
#include <string>
 | 
						|
#include <vector>
 | 
						|
#include <random>
 | 
						|
#include <thread>
 | 
						|
 | 
						|
//
 | 
						|
// CLI argument parsing
 | 
						|
//
 | 
						|
 | 
						|
struct gpt_params {
 | 
						|
    int32_t seed          = -1;   // RNG seed
 | 
						|
    int32_t n_threads     = std::min(4, (int32_t) std::thread::hardware_concurrency());
 | 
						|
    int32_t n_predict     = 128;  // new tokens to predict
 | 
						|
    int32_t repeat_last_n = 64;   // last n tokens to penalize
 | 
						|
    int32_t n_parts       = -1;   // amount of model parts (-1 = determine from model dimensions)
 | 
						|
    int32_t n_ctx         = 512;  // context size
 | 
						|
    int32_t n_batch       = 8;    // batch size for prompt processing
 | 
						|
    int32_t n_keep        = 0;    // number of tokens to keep from initial prompt
 | 
						|
 | 
						|
    // sampling parameters
 | 
						|
    int32_t top_k = 40;
 | 
						|
    float   top_p = 0.95f;
 | 
						|
    float   temp  = 0.80f;
 | 
						|
    float   repeat_penalty  = 1.10f;
 | 
						|
 | 
						|
    std::string model  = "models/lamma-7B/ggml-model.bin"; // model path
 | 
						|
    std::string prompt = "";
 | 
						|
    std::string input_prefix = "";       // string to prefix user inputs with
 | 
						|
    std::vector<std::string> antiprompt; // string upon seeing which more user input is prompted
 | 
						|
 | 
						|
    std::string lora_adapter = "";  // lora adapter path
 | 
						|
    std::string lora_base = "";     // base model path for the lora adapter
 | 
						|
 | 
						|
    bool memory_f16        = true;  // use f16 instead of f32 for memory kv
 | 
						|
    bool random_prompt     = false; // do not randomize prompt if none provided
 | 
						|
    bool use_color         = false; // use color to distinguish generations and inputs
 | 
						|
    bool interactive       = false; // interactive mode
 | 
						|
 | 
						|
    bool embedding         = false; // get only sentence embedding
 | 
						|
    bool interactive_start = false; // wait for user input immediately
 | 
						|
 | 
						|
    bool instruct          = false; // instruction mode (used for Alpaca models)
 | 
						|
    bool ignore_eos        = false; // do not stop generating after eos
 | 
						|
    bool perplexity        = false; // compute perplexity over the prompt
 | 
						|
    bool use_mmap          = true;  // use mmap for faster loads
 | 
						|
    bool use_mlock         = false; // use mlock to keep model in memory
 | 
						|
    bool mem_test          = false; // compute maximum memory usage
 | 
						|
    bool verbose_prompt    = false; // print prompt tokens before generation
 | 
						|
};
 | 
						|
 | 
						|
bool gpt_params_parse(int argc, char ** argv, gpt_params & params);
 | 
						|
 | 
						|
void gpt_print_usage(int argc, char ** argv, const gpt_params & params);
 | 
						|
 | 
						|
std::string gpt_random_prompt(std::mt19937 & rng);
 | 
						|
 | 
						|
//
 | 
						|
// Vocab utils
 | 
						|
//
 | 
						|
 | 
						|
std::vector<llama_token> llama_tokenize(struct llama_context * ctx, const std::string & text, bool add_bos);
 | 
						|
 | 
						|
//
 | 
						|
// Console utils
 | 
						|
//
 | 
						|
 | 
						|
#define ANSI_COLOR_RED     "\x1b[31m"
 | 
						|
#define ANSI_COLOR_GREEN   "\x1b[32m"
 | 
						|
#define ANSI_COLOR_YELLOW  "\x1b[33m"
 | 
						|
#define ANSI_COLOR_BLUE    "\x1b[34m"
 | 
						|
#define ANSI_COLOR_MAGENTA "\x1b[35m"
 | 
						|
#define ANSI_COLOR_CYAN    "\x1b[36m"
 | 
						|
#define ANSI_COLOR_RESET   "\x1b[0m"
 | 
						|
#define ANSI_BOLD          "\x1b[1m"
 | 
						|
 | 
						|
enum console_color_t {
 | 
						|
    CONSOLE_COLOR_DEFAULT=0,
 | 
						|
    CONSOLE_COLOR_PROMPT,
 | 
						|
    CONSOLE_COLOR_USER_INPUT
 | 
						|
};
 | 
						|
 | 
						|
struct console_state {
 | 
						|
    bool use_color = false;
 | 
						|
    console_color_t color = CONSOLE_COLOR_DEFAULT;
 | 
						|
};
 | 
						|
 | 
						|
void set_console_color(console_state & con_st, console_color_t color);
 | 
						|
 | 
						|
#if defined (_WIN32)
 | 
						|
void win32_console_init(bool enable_color);
 | 
						|
void win32_utf8_encode(const std::wstring & wstr, std::string & str);
 | 
						|
#endif
